Table 2 Biochemical reactions, ATP yield and average stoichiometric number used in the thermodynamic potential factor calculation

From: Enrichment of syngas-converting mixed microbial consortia for ethanol production and thermodynamics-based design of enrichment strategies

Stoichiometry of biochemical reactions

ATP yield (mol per reaction)

χ

Refs.

H2/CO2 conversion into acetate/ethanol

 4 H2 + 2 CO2 → CH3COO + H+ + 2 H2O

0.3

2

[40]

 6 H2 + 2 CO2 → CH3CH2OH + 3 H2O

− 0.1/0.3a

3

[40]

CO conversion into acetate/ethanol

 4 CO + 2 H2O → CH3COO + H+ + 2 CO2

1.5

4

[40]

 6 CO + 3 H2O → CH3CH2OH + 4 CO2

1.7

6

[40]

VFA reduction to corresponding alcohols

 CH3COO + H+ + 2 H2 → CH3CH2OH + H2O

0.33

4

[42]

 CH3(CH2)2COO + H+ + 2 H2 → CH3(CH2)2CH2OH + H2O

0.33

4

[42]

 CH3COO + H+ + 2 CO + H2O → CH3CH2OH + 2 CO2

0.66

5

 

 CH3(CH2)2COO + H+ + 2 CO + H2O → CH3(CH2)2CH2OH + 2 CO2

0.66

5

 

Chain elongation

 5 CH3CH2OH + 3 CH3COO → 4 CH3(CH2)2COO + H+ + 3 H2O + 2 H2

1

1

[41]

  1. aBertsch and Müller [40] predicted an ATP yield of − 0.1; however, the possibility of a positive ATP yield was also evaluated
